Mango exports from Pakistan face problems with freshness

News from the All Pakistan Fruit and Vegetable Exporters, Importers, and Merchants Association shows that the mango exports from Pakistan to China reached a new high this year.

Chinese Economy Online explained that the growing mango export from Pakistan is due to currency devaluation, a strict implementation of international standards, and various promotional activities abroad. Chinese Economy Online organized the Pakistan Beijing Mango Festival with importers and exporters at the embassy of Pakistan in Beijing.

The flavor of mangoes from Pakistan is very popular with Chinese consumers. Some Chinese consumers call the mangoes from Pakistan "the most delicious mangoes in the world". However, the export of mangoes from Pakistan to China is limited by the difficulty of keeping mangoes fresh during transport. This means that the mango price is relatively high. About 60%-70% of the mangoes exported from Pakistan are freighted by sea. This is not a problem for traditional markets in Arab countries or in some European countries, but transport to potential markets in China, Korea, Japan, and the USA takes longer and requires a new solution.

Mangoes from Southeast Asia have a competitive advantage over the mangoes from Pakistan because transport is quicker and the price is lower.
